BMW K 1600 GT 2024

BMW K 1600 GT 2024

The BMW 6-cylinder glides over the road in 2022 with a lot of elegance and a lot of equipment. This time, the new headlight technology was outstanding. The engine tuning and the new ESA chassis are also well done this time. Surprisingly, the wind protection is not perfect and perfectionists will miss an adaptive cruise control. The sovereign 6-cylinder is in the form of its life in the current model year. One enjoys the engine in every situation. The K 1600 GT is a magnificently dimensioned sports tourer that offers a practical balance between comfort and agility.

GT still passes for a sports tourer - surprisingly good performance

Smooth engine

Great engine response

Motorcycle generally accessible and easy to use despite its imposing appearance

Good headlight technology

Great display - always easy to read

Comprehensive integration of smartphone into vehicle

Map navigation via BMW Connected App

Good balance between stability and handling

Neutral ride

Good brakes and stable chassis.

Connection from mobile phone to vehicle works well in most cases - but when it hangs up it gets annoying

buttons and switches in the cockpit not backlit

wind protection not perfectly solved - always a draughty feeling in the saddle

no adaptive cruise control - you would expect this from a touring motorbike in this league

mobile phone compartment snagged from time to time during the test - be careful when stuffing in mobile phones that are too large.
